Hi all — as I hand the discount file over to Director Maren Faulke, a quick recap for branch managers. Quillstone Supply's big-ticket discounting has drifted; some branches are stacking volume and loyalty rebates, which was never the intent. Maren will reissue the approval matrix and tighten the threshold for anything over the standard band. Keep deals in the pipeline moving, but flag outliers early rather than late. One more thing before I sign off: please read the confidential note on our business plans below.

board note of baguf-fafog: Kasixox Foods plans to lower the Drueth list price by 48 percent in March.

Runbook: GarageSense occupancy feed stall. If the Larkvale deck shows stale counts for >10 min, restart the ingest worker on the Penner node. Verify the sensor relay heartbeat resumes within 2 min. If counts still freeze, flush the occupancy cache and replay the last hour from the buffer queue. Escalate to the feed team only after replay fails twice. When filing the ticket, include the trace token printed below.

session token of tajef-bageg = htk21_5d90d574934f3ccae6437

## Tuning — tailgrep

For the sync: tailgrep's defaults were chosen for the Harkness staging fleet, not prod. The follow buffer and poll interval dominate CPU at high line rates; batch size dominates memory. Don't raise all three together — we saw 3x RSS growth doing that last quarter. Per-host overrides go in the usual config. Shipping defaults are listed below.

tuning table, kahop-fahog:
RATE_LIMITS = {
    "wenix": 1,
    "druael": 10,
    "holix": 1,
    "zorael": 1,
}